CVE-2026-35415: Windows Storage Spaces Controller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ability
Integer overflow or wraparound in Windows Storage Spaces Controller allows an authorized attacker to elevate privileges locally.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the severity of CVE-2026-35415?
CVE-2026-35415 has a high severity as it allows an authorized attacker to elevate privileges locally on affected systems.
How do I fix CVE-2026-35415?
To fix CVE-2026-35415, apply the latest security patches provided by Microsoft for the affected products.
Which systems are affected by CVE-2026-35415?
CVE-2026-35415 affects several Microsoft products, including Windows Server 2012 R2, Windows 10, Windows 11, and Windows Server 2022.
Can CVE-2026-35415 be exploited remotely?
No, CVE-2026-35415 requires local access to exploit the vulnerability as it is an elevation of privilege issue.
What is the nature of the vulnerability in CVE-2026-35415?
CVE-2026-35415 is caused by an integer overflow or wraparound in the Windows Storage Spaces Controller.
